    Fun atmosphere and great sense of humor from the decor and staff on down to the meal and holiday drink names (i.e., Die Semi-Hard and The Bipolar Express). If you've eaten in Pueblo, Colorado, you'll know the staples like Sloppers and Passkeys Sandwiches. Honor Farm does a nice job at paying homage to the unique Pueblo-style culinary. The Grilled Cheese with a green chili was OUT OF THIS WORLD. Pueblo may not be known for their Grilled Cheese but this was so surprisingly good. The green chili really added the perfect spice/heat. We also ordered the smothered green chili burger which brought such fond memories of the Pueblo food scene. You can order with your choice of sweet potato or regular fries and in hindsight, I would should have ordered on the side.

    I had already been impressed by the Death & Co in NYC, so I knew I had to try their branch in…read moreDenver. I was not disappointed. A moody, velvet filled space with a comfortable bar. Laid back vibe and welcoming staff. Nothing pretentious at all. The bartenders were knowledgeable and gave great suggestions. Always stayed on top of my drinks. The thing I like most about Death & Co is the way the categorize their drinks: Light and playful, bright and confident, elegant and timeless, boozy and honest, and rich and comforting. I had the aqua profunda (cognac, St. George basil eau di vie, lillet rose, strawberry, lime, and absinthe). I also had the eight limb daiquiri (rum, Canada aguardiente, Thai tea cordial, lime leaf, and Maraschino). The Blood Oath (mezcal, Vecchio del capo, Calabrian chili amaro, St. Germain Elderflower, lavender, honey, lemon). All were complex and delicious. You could pick out every flavor, yet everything melded together so well. They also have some basic bar food and snacks, but somewhat elevated. I had the D&C Burger and it was juicy, rich, and had some great accompanying fries. I usually try to give a more in depth idea of cocktails available, but Death & Co has such a diverse menu with so many amazing craft cocktails that I can't offer that this time . . . you'll have to go in and see it for yourself!
